甲型H1N1流感病毒(原称人感染猪流感病毒)是一种新的流感病毒。这种新型病毒是美国于2009年4月在人体中首次检出的。截止2009年5月11日,世界卫生组织公布:墨西哥、美国、加拿大等29个国家和地区已经报告实验室确诊甲型H1N1流感病例。此病毒可通过人与人传播,同季节性流感病毒的传染方式非常相似。  相似文献

目的 调查山东省2017 - 2018流感监测年度甲型H1N1流感病毒对神经氨酸酶抑制剂(NAI)的耐药情况,分析其神经氨酸酶(NA)基因特征。方法 选取山东省2017 - 2018流感监测年度分离的20株甲型H1N1流感病毒进行生物学耐药实验,检测病毒对奥司他韦和扎那米韦的药物敏感性。提取病毒核酸后对NA基因进行测序,利用生物信息学软件分析NA基因上与耐药有关的氨基酸位点及其基因变异情况。结果 选取的20株甲型H1N1流感病毒全部对奥司他韦和扎那米韦敏感,对奥司他韦的IC50平均数为0.37 nM(0.15~0.89 nM),对扎那米韦的IC50平均数为0.28 nM(0.14~0.78 nM)。NA基因测序结果也没有发现导致耐药的突变位点。结论 山东省的甲型H1N1流感病毒对NAI敏感,临床上可继续使用此类药物对流感患者进行治疗。  相似文献

目的分析亳州市2013年一所学校流感暴发疫情甲型H1N1流感病毒基因及抗原变异情况。方法从132名具有流感症状的学生当中随机采集10份标本,用Realtime RT-PCR方法鉴定甲型H1N1流感病毒,对阳性标本接种MDCK细胞,分离流感病毒,并对甲型H1N1流感病毒株进行血凝素(HA)作基因测序,分析基因及氨基酸位点变异情况。结果 10份标本中Realtime RT-PCR鉴定有8份为甲型H1N1流感病毒核酸阳性,病毒分离培养6份阳性,并对其进行基因测序,HA基因与疫苗株同源性为98.4%,HA基因氨基酸变异分析显示,有多个位点发生变异。结论此次暴发的甲型H1N1流感病毒的基因组HA序列与我国及其他国家的甲型H1N1流感病毒具有较高的同源性,HA基因氨基酸序列发生变异情况,需密切关注甲型H1N1的流行状况。  相似文献

[目的]掌握住院严重急性呼吸道感染(SARI)病例甲型H1N1流感病毒感染情况,为流感防治工作提供依据。[方法]2009年第48周至2010年第12周,对济宁市县级及以上医疗机构报告的208例住院SARI病例进行调查与流感病原检测。[结果]208例SARI病例中,70.19%有慢性病或为孕产妇,20~49岁占62.12%;流感病毒核酸阳性率为32.69%,其中甲型H1N1流感病毒核酸阳性率为18.27%,季节性H1N1型流感病毒核酸阳性率为0.48%,H3N2型流感病毒核酸阳性率为8.65%,B型流感病毒核酸阳性率为5.29%。208例住院SARI病例病死率为2.88%,其中甲型H1N1流感危重症病例2例死亡。[结论]住院SARI病例甲型H1N1流感病毒感染率较高。  相似文献

目的对长沙市甲型H1N1流感病毒A/changsha/78/2009的神经氨酸酶(neuraminidase,NA)基因进行测序分析,以期了解该病毒的来源及变异情况。方法利用国家流感中心(CNIC)和世界卫生组织(WHO)推荐的NA基因测序引物和CEQTM8000 Genetic Analysis System对2009年长沙市甲型H1N1流感患者阳性鼻咽拭子标本(A/changsha/78/2009)进行测序,测序结果提交至GenBank并利用Lasergene和Mega5软件对测序结果进行氨基酸比对和进化树分析。结果 A/changsha/78/2009 NA基因GenBank登录号为:GQ463958.1,与瑞典斯德哥尔摩甲型H1N1流感病毒分离株A/Stockholm/37/2009(H1N1)核苷酸同源性为100%;进化树分析显示A/changsha/78/2009 NA基因属于欧亚猪流感分支,包含A/changsha/78/2009在内的甲型H1N1流感病毒与A/swine/Spain/WVL6/1991(H1N1)亲缘关系近;A/chang-sha/78/2009与A/swine/Spain/WVL6/1991 NA基因均有7个潜在糖基化位点,A/changsha/78/2009 NA基因未发生H274Y位点突变。结论包含A/changsha/78/2009在内的甲型H1N1流感病毒NA基因可能来源于欧亚猪流感病毒,A/changsha/78/2009病毒对神经氨酸酶抑制剂类药物敏感。  相似文献

目的分析广州市城区人群甲型H1N1流感病毒感染状况,了解甲型H1N1流感的流行病学特征。方法采用随机抽样的方法,在广州市5大城区采集不同年龄的、没有接种甲型H1N1流感疫苗的人群血清样本。采用血凝抑制试验检测血清中甲型H1N1流感病毒抗体。结果本次共调查1 326人,检出甲型H1N1流感病毒抗体阳性300例,阳性率为22.6%。不同年龄组人群的甲型H1N1流感病毒血清抗体阳性率差异有统计学意义(P〈0.01),以5~14和15~24岁年龄组的阳性率最高,分别为32.9%(138/420)和31.6%(81/256)。300例甲型H1N1流感病毒血清抗体阳性者中,有96例(占32.0%)没有出现过流感样症状。结论学龄人群和年轻人群是广州市甲型H1N1流感病毒最大的感染群体。在感染人群里,有一定比例的人是没有出现流感样症状的。  相似文献

H1N1 vaccination     
Early results (January to April) from the 2010 Canadian Community Health Survey show that an estimated 41% of Canadians (excluding those in the territories) aged 12 or older had been vaccinated for H1N1 by April 2010. The percentages were higher in the Atlantic provinces, Quebec and Saskatchewan than in Canada overall. Relatively high percentages of females and people aged 45 or older were vaccinated; the percentage of immigrants who had done so was relatively low. Being in a priority group (health-care worker, having children younger than 5 in the household, or having a chronic condition that could increase the risk for complications from H1N1) increased the likelihood of vaccination. A history of seasonal flu vaccination and having a regular doctor were also associated with H1N1 vaccination. Nearly three-quarters of those who had not been vaccinated reported that they did not think it was necessary.  相似文献

目的 探讨被动吸烟、cyp1b1、gstp1、sult1a1基因多态性及其联合作用对乳腺癌发病的影响。方法 2014 - 2015年间,采用病例-对照研究方法,收集病例794例,对照805例。问卷调查收集研究对象信息。采用飞行质谱技术,进行cyp1b1、gstp1、sult1a1基因单核苷酸多态性分型检测。采用多因素非条件 logistic 回归,分析环境烟草烟雾暴露及cyp1b1、gstp1、sult1a1基因多态性与乳腺癌发病风险的关系。结果 调整年龄、教育程度、家庭年总收入、职业、婚姻状况后,环境烟草烟雾暴露与gstp1基因多态性未发现协同作用。以环境烟草烟雾低暴露且携带 cyp1b1 rs1056836 C等位基因为参照,环境烟草烟雾高暴露且携带 GG 基因在绝经前女性中乳腺癌风险明显增高(OR = 1.678,95%CI:1.039~2.711)。以环境烟草烟雾组合低暴露且携带sult1a1 rs9282861GG基因型为参照,环境烟草烟雾高暴露且携带A等位基因绝经前乳腺癌风险明显增高(OR = 2.389,95%CI:1.157~4.931),但交互作用系数无统计学意义。结论 环境烟草烟雾高暴露与cyp1b1 及sult1a1基因对乳腺癌发病风险可能存在协同作用,但尚扩大样本进行验证。  相似文献

NF1 gene and neurofibromatosis 1   总被引:10,自引:0,他引:10  
Neurofibromatosis 1 (NF1), also known as von Recklinghausen disease, is an autosomal dominant condition caused by mutations of the NF1 gene, which is located at chromosome 17q11.2. NF1 is believed to be completely penetrant, but substantial variability in expression of features occurs. Diagnosis of NF1 is based on established clinical criteria. The presentation of many of the clinical features is age dependent. The average life expectancy of patients with NF1 is probably reduced by 10-15 years, and malignancy is the most common cause of death. The prevalence of clinically diagnosed NF1 ranges from 1/2,000 to 1/5,000 in most population-based studies. A wide variety of NF1 mutations has been found in patients with NF1, but no frequently recurring mutation has been identified. Most studies have not found an obvious relation between particular NF1 mutations and the resulting clinical manifestations. The variability of the NF1 phenotype, even in individuals with the same NF1 gene mutation, suggests that other factors are involved in determining the clinical manifestations, but the nature of these factors has not yet been determined. Laboratory testing for NF1 mutations is difficult. A protein truncation test is commercially available, but its sensitivity, specificity, and predictive value have not been established. No general, population-based molecular studies of NF1 mutations have been performed. At this time, it appears that the benefits of population-based screening for clinical features of NF1 would not outweigh the costs of screening.  相似文献

目的 研究GSTM1、GSTT1和GSTP1基因多态性对多环芳烃接触工人尿中1-羟基芘(1-OHP)水平的影响.方法 分别选取2个炼焦厂共447名多环芳烃职业接触工人(接触组)和某线材厂220名非职业接触工人(对照组)作为研究对象,采用高效液相色谱法测定尿中1-OHP水平,采用线性回归统计模型分析GSTM1和GSTT1缺失型及GSTP1 I105V位点的多态性对不同人群尿中1-OHP水平的修饰作用.结果 接触组工人尿中1-OHP浓度为4.61 μmol/mol Cr,明显高于对照组(0.34μmol/mol Cr),差异有统计学意义(P<0.05).接触类别和吸烟分别是影响尿中1-OHP水平的主要因素,在控制各混杂因素的影响后,线性回归分析显示,接触组尿中1-OHP水平和GSTP1 I105V位点多态性有关(单基因分析,P=0.012;多基因分析,P=0.011),对总体样本,单基因模型和多基因模型均显示,尿中1-OHP水平可能和GSTT1缺失型多态有关(P=0.055),多基因交互作用分析显示,GSTT1和GSTP1基因多态对接触组尿中1-OHP水平具有交互作用.结论 谷胱甘肽硫转移酶(GSTs)基因的多态性对接触多环芳烃工人尿中1-OHP水平有影响.
Abstract:
Objective To investigate the modification of GSTM1, GSTT1 and GSTP1 gene polymorphisms on urinary 1-hydroxypyrene (1-OHP) excretions in workers under different exposure levels. Methods Four hundred and forty-seven occupationally exposed workers from two coking plants and 220 control workers from a wire rod plant were genotyped to analyze the modification of GSTM1, GSTT1 and GSTP1 gene polymorphisms on urinary 1-OHP excretions. Results The urinary 1-OHP concentration in exposed group was much higher than that in control group (4.61 vs 0.34 μmol/mol Cr, P<0.05). Occupational exposure levels and cigarette smoking were of the dominating factors affecting 1-OHP excretions in urine. After controlling potential confounders, decreased excretion of urinary 1-OHP was associated with GSTP1 I105V AG + GG genotype in coke oven workers (single-gene model, P=0.012; multi-gene model, P=0.011 ) and with GSTT1 null type in the analysis including all subjects (P=0.055 in both single-gene and multi-gene models). GSTT1 and GSTP1 were interacted on the urinary concentrations of 1-OHP. Conclusion Urinary 1-OHP concentrations can be modified by GSTM1, GSTT1 and GSTP1 gene polymorphisms, indicating that these genes are involved in the metabolism of polycyclic aromatic hydrocarbons.  相似文献

The pandemic A/H1N1 influenza viruses emerged in both Mexico and the United States in March 2009, and were transmitted efficiently in the human population. They were transmitted occasionally from humans to other mammals including pigs, dogs and cats. In this study, we report the isolation and genetic analysis of novel viruses in pigs in China. These viruses were related phylogenetically to the pandemic 2009 H1N1 influenza viruses isolated from humans and pigs, which indicates that the pandemic virus is currently circulating in swine populations, and this hypothesis was further supported by serological surveillance of pig sera collected within the same period. Furthermore, we isolated another two H1N1 viruses belonging to the lineages of classical swine H1N1 virus and avian-like swine H1N1 virus, respectively. Multiple genetic lineages of H1N1 viruses are co-circulating in the swine population, which highlights the importance of intensive surveillance for swine influenza in China.  相似文献
